Colombian coffee bean growers began an effort Tuesday to boost income, opening their own coffee shop in Manhattan. Take that, Starbucks! ;-) “New York’s 2,000-square-foot store, which can seat about 200 customers, will be considered the flagship of an eventual 300 Juan Valdez stores worldwide.” — Now I’m eagerly waiting for Juan Valdez to come and open a shop here in Montreal.
